Output 0392115c83f474e98ebb4a6d357b571b7f199dedbdd3dd00a9cec76cf2a65626:0

value
20127872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50cf6dc2617aea4ed6693a9c332c780f068d451c OP_EQUAL
address
394JUHuG4uHUyQgAWrKJMNyAGhHXPWrJCd
transaction
0392115c83f474e98ebb4a6d357b571b7f199dedbdd3dd00a9cec76cf2a65626
spent
true